Fast forward one week ahead and we have also a MongoDB binding and
performance that's already roughly on par with the H2 MK (see for
example OAK-624). I'm increasingly confident that this SegmentMK
concept will work really well also in practice.

There's still a number of missing features and optimizations that I
started to list as subtasks of OAK-593. I'll start working on OAK-630
(compareAgainstBaseState) and will follow up on the others after that.
If anyone else feels like joining the effort, feel free to pick one of
the subtasks or come up with new ones.

I'll also be looking at improving our performance and scalability
benchmarks to provide better insight on where we are in the big
picture and what are the most pressing issues to focus on.
